Real Estate Advisor Job: Description, Roles, Responsibilities, and Skills

Last Updated Mar 23, 2025

A Real Estate Advisor provides expert guidance to clients on property purchases, sales, and investments, ensuring informed decisions in a competitive market. They conduct thorough market analysis, evaluate property values, and offer strategic advice tailored to individual client needs. Strong communication skills and in-depth knowledge of real estate laws and trends are essential for success in this role.

Key Responsibilities of a Real Estate Advisor

A Real Estate Advisor provides expert guidance to clients seeking to buy, sell, or invest in properties. They analyze market trends, property values, and client needs to offer tailored recommendations.

Key responsibilities include conducting thorough property research and preparing detailed financial reports. They also negotiate contracts, coordinate property inspections, and ensure compliance with local real estate laws and regulations.

Qualifications and Education Requirements

Becoming a Real Estate Advisor requires a solid foundation in relevant education and specific qualifications. Understanding the essential requirements helps you prepare for a successful career in real estate advisory services.

  • High School Diploma or Equivalent - This is the minimum educational requirement to enter the real estate field and pursue further certifications.
  • Real Estate License - Obtaining a state-issued license is mandatory, which involves passing a comprehensive exam covering laws and property regulations.
  • Continuing Education - Real estate advisors must regularly update their knowledge through courses to stay compliant and informed about industry changes.

Strong educational background and proper licensing ensure your credibility as a proficient Real Estate Advisor.

Career Growth and Opportunities for Real Estate Advisors

Aspect Details
Career Growth The real estate advisor profession offers significant career growth through continuous skill development, certifications, and expanding market knowledge. Progression opportunities include senior advisor roles, team leadership, and specialization in luxury properties or commercial real estate.
Market Demand The growing housing market and commercial developments increase demand for real estate advisors. This trend supports steady employment and potential for higher income with experience and proven sales success.
Skill Enhancement Successful advisors improve negotiation, client relationship management, and market analysis skills. Staying updated on local regulations and digital marketing trends significantly boosts career advancement.
Income Potential Real estate advisors typically earn commissions based on property sales. High-performing advisors who build strong client networks often achieve substantial financial rewards and bonuses.
Networking Building connections with developers, lenders, and other real estate professionals opens doors to exclusive listings and referral opportunities, accelerating career progress.
